God speaks comfort and hope through Jeremiah to the exiles from Judah. Despite the pain of exile and judgment, God still has Judah's welfare in mind. God sent Judah into exile for their injustice and rejection of the covenant. But once the time comes, God will bring them back to their land again. God has not abandoned God's people.

That doesn't mean God brings trouble on us, but it does mean God can bring good out of evil. What might exile mean to us today? What would it mean for God to bring us home? When we seek God, we will find him. The path is not always clear, but God is with us.

Jeremiah 29:10-14

10For thus says the Lord: Only when Babylon’s seventy years are completed will I visit you, and I will fulfill to you my promise and bring you back to this place. 11For surely I know the plans I have for you, says the Lord, plans for your welfare and not for harm, to give you a future with hope.

12Then when you call upon me and come and pray to me, I will hear you. 13When you search for me, you will find me; if you seek me with all your heart, 14I will let you find me, says the Lord, and I will restore your fortunes and gather you from all the nations and all the places where I have driven you, says the Lord, and I will bring you back to the place from which I sent you into exile.
